hc
2024-02-20 102a0743326a03cd1a1202ceda21e175b7d3575c
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
// SPDX-License-Identifier: GPL-2.0 OR X11
/*
 * Copyright 2019 (C) Pengutronix, Marco Felsch <kernel@pengutronix.de>
 */
 
#include "imx6q.dtsi"
#include "imx6qdl-kontron-samx6i.dtsi"
#include <dt-bindings/gpio/gpio.h>
 
/ {
   model = "Kontron SMARC sAMX6i Quad/Dual";
   compatible = "kontron,imx6q-samx6i", "fsl,imx6q";
};
 
/* Quad/Dual SoMs have 3 chip-select signals */
&ecspi4 {
   cs-gpios = <&gpio3 24 GPIO_ACTIVE_LOW>,
          <&gpio3 29 GPIO_ACTIVE_LOW>,
          <&gpio3 25 GPIO_ACTIVE_LOW>;
};
 
&pinctrl_ecspi4 {
   fsl,pins = <
       MX6QDL_PAD_EIM_D21__ECSPI4_SCLK 0x100b1
       MX6QDL_PAD_EIM_D28__ECSPI4_MOSI 0x100b1
       MX6QDL_PAD_EIM_D22__ECSPI4_MISO 0x100b1
 
       /* SPI4_IMX_CS2# - connected to internal flash */
       MX6QDL_PAD_EIM_D24__GPIO3_IO24 0x1b0b0
       /* SPI4_IMX_CS0# - connected to SMARC SPI0_CS0# */
       MX6QDL_PAD_EIM_D29__GPIO3_IO29 0x1b0b0
       /* SPI4_CS3# - connected to  SMARC SPI0_CS1# */
       MX6QDL_PAD_EIM_D25__GPIO3_IO25 0x1b0b0
   >;
};